Most of the common challenge a new homeowner encounters is whether to use curtains or blinds. Admittedly, I had the same dilemma 10 years ago. Eventually, I opted to go for curtains and I never looked back.
Here are a couple of tips to help you decide:
Installation
When installing curtains, all you need is a curtain rod that comes in variety of colors and shapes. In most cases, you can install the curtain rod without seeking professional help. While on the other hand, installing blinds can be sometimes complicated and may result to hiring the professional.
Maintenance
Once installed, that is pretty much it for the blinds. Cleaning can also be so painful. Instead, what you need to do is clean the blind layer per layer. You also need to be extra cautious when cleaning blinds, you don't want to create permanent dent to it. With curtains on the other hand, it is easy to wash them then hang a freshly ironed one.
Flexibility
Depending on your mood, you can replace the curtain of your choice. You can achieve a breezy feel to a dimly lit living space. With blinds however, we all know how limited your options are.
